Output 541515bc38ca29c4f68cd53bb61643b26a1c288c1c411683493feb3947c779b1:11

value
709120666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d8751d684a52b5226a381af5694d1ef2f317f5 OP_EQUAL
address
3LN95QXpvXpjv59wztCZTy9onh6ThZxtBX
transaction
541515bc38ca29c4f68cd53bb61643b26a1c288c1c411683493feb3947c779b1
spent
true